The Pathway to the M.S. in Information Systems (MSIS) program at the Rawls College of Business offers undergraduate students a valuable opportunity to get a head start on their graduate education by enrolling in up to six hours of graduate-level coursework before completing their bachelors degree. This pathway allows students to accelerate their academic and professional goals while saving both time and tuition.
The MSIS is a 36-credit, 100% online program designed to develop advanced skills at the intersection of technology and business. Students build expertise in areas such as enterprise architecture, web development, and emerging technologies, preparing them to lead in todays tech-driven organizations. The flexible online format allows graduates to continue advancing their education seamlessly after completing their undergraduate degree.

Career-Defining Curriculum
The MSIS curriculum is design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of data management, information systems, and strategic decision-making.
Core courses include:
Business Application Scripting
Database Concepts
Risk Management in Information Systems
Data Structures for Business Applications
Web Application Development
Interface Design & UX for Business
Web3 Infrastructure Development
Enterprise Architecture & System Integration

Application Requirements
Applicants must hold a bachelor's degree and will benefit from prior coursework in computer science, management information systems, statistics, and calculus. Experience with programming languages like Python, SQL, and R is recommended. No prior work experience is required.
Unofficial Transcripts
Applicants must submit unofficial transcripts from any degree-awarding college or university, as well as any post-secondary institution attended.
Resume
Applicants must submit a detailed current resume, indicating professional work experience—including start and end dates (month and year) for each position held. Provide accomplishments and skills acquired, including managerial experience.
English Proficiency for International Students
All international applicants must provide proof of English proficiency before their applications can be considered for admission. Only your most recent measure of English proficiency is considered for admission purposes. This test is waived only for graduates of U.S. universities or universities in English proficiency-exempt countries. Applicants who have completed at least two consecutive years at a college or university in the U.S. or in an English proficiency-exempt country are also exempt from the English proficiency requirement.
Application Deadlines
Fall Entry: July 1
Spring Entry: December 1
International students are encouraged to apply at least six months in advance when possible.
